Joseph William Gilgun, born on March 9, 1984, in Chorley, Lancashire, is a celebrated English actor renowned for his diverse and impactful roles in television and film. He gained significant recognition as Vinnie O'Neill in the Sky One dramedy series **Brassic**, and as Eli Dingle in the popular ITV soap **Emmerdale**. Prior to these roles, he portrayed Jamie Armstrong on the long-standing ITV show **Coronation Street** and captured audiences as Woody in the critically acclaimed film **This Is England** (2006) and its spin-off series. Additionally, Gilgun showcased his talent as Rudy Wade in the E4 series **Misfits**. Between 2016 and 2019, he starred as Cassidy, the Irish vampire, in the AMC adaptation of the Vertigo comic **Preacher**.

Growing up in Rivington, Lancashire, in a working-class family, Gilgun faced challenges such as dyslexia and ADHD, which he candidly discusses in interviews alongside his experiences with depression and anxiety. His journey into acting began at eight, following the advice of an educational psychologist, leading him to various drama workshops. He made his television debut at the age of ten in **Coronation Street**, remaining with the show until he was thirteen. After completing his A-Levels at Runshaw College and working as a plasterer, he returned to acting full-time in 2006 with **Emmerdale**, marking the start of a successful career that continues to flourish.
